I've got the 10" from Fastaire that I use for long rides. In town, I still use the stock. W/ the 10, I have no issues with wind. It doesn't look as cool as stock, but definitely makes a difference. I'm 6'3".
I started with the HD EG std height 12" clear shield on mine. Just upgraded to the National Cycle VStream 14" clear shield. I am 5'10." Both shields deflects the airflow over top the helmet by about two inches and that is perfect for me. When mounted, the top of both shields are about the same distance from the fairing edge.
got the 4 inch stock and an 8 inch from fast aire, its a big "improvement" over the stock as far as buffeting...Im 5'9 and the wind just touches the top of my head on the hwy..the 8 is the lowest I'd go for any real touring, I think the 10 inch clear would be perfect for me.

If you want a low windshield but don't like a lot of wind in your face, you should look in to a recurve. The shield in my sig pic is a 8" clearview recurve. I'm a fraction under 6', and I can stick my hand up and feel the windstream just over the top of my helmet.
